:SELinux is preventing /usr/sbin/squid from 'read' accesses on the file /var/log/squid/cache.log.
:
:*****  Plugin catchall (100. confidence) suggests  ***************************
:
:If you believe that squid should be allowed read access on the cache.log file by default.
:Then you should report this as a bug.
:You can generate a local policy module to allow this access.
:Do
:allow this access for now by executing:
:# grep squid /var/log/audit/audit.log | audit2allow -M mypol
:# semodule -i mypol.pp

Comment 1 Miroslav Grepl 2012-07-19 21:59:49 UTC
# matchpathcon /var/log/squid/cache.log
/var/log/squid/cache.log	system_u:object_r:squid_log_t:s

Execute:

# restorecon -R -v /var/log/squid/cache.log

Comment 2 Miroslav Grepl 2012-07-19 22:00:57 UTC
Actually execute

# restorecon -R -v /var/log
